As a Junior Project Manager in Yacht Building, you will support the Head of Project Management in overseeing the construction of new luxury yachts. This role involves coordinating various tasks, liaising with clients, managing resources, and ensuring projects are completed efficiently and on schedule.
Key Responsibilities:
Project Coordination:
- Assist in developing and maintaining project plans and schedules. Ensure the respect of Project milestones
- Monitor and control project progress.
- Coordinate with different departments to ensure alignment with project timelines.
- Follow up on daily basis project evolution, solved and report any issues during the production
- Report to the Project Manager Head on construction activities and project progress.
- Resource Management:
- Help in identifying and allocating resources, including manpower, materials, and equipment.
- Anticipate workload. Assign collective and individual responsibilities
- Ensure efficient utilization of resources to meet project goals.
- Coordinate approved third party contractors and manage coactivity on board
- Identify, source and approved equipment and material requests for project as per design requirement within approved budget.
Client Relationship Management:
- Serve as the liaison between the client and the shipyard throughout the project lifecycle.
- Guide clients through the customization process by explaining technical posibilities and limitations.
- Foster long-term relationships to support potential future projects, refits, or upgrades.
- Maintain confidentiality and discretion while managing high-value transactions and clients' bespoke requests.
- Ensure that the client’s expectations are aligned with final quality checks and delivery timing.
Technical Support:
- Assist in resolving technical issues related to yacht construction or design.
- Liaise with engineers, designers, production team and suppliers.
- Conduct regular project meetings to update progress, address any issues and ensure project specifications are met.
- Identify and anticipate risks that might impact a schedule and propose solutions to mitigate together with the Production Manager Head.
- Resolve technical issues pertaining to construction
- Liaise with Design Department in order to receive drawings on time and ensure that Production team is aware of to support project progress.
Quality Assurance:
- Ensure all construction activities meet quality standards.
- Work with the Quality Control team to conduct inspections and audits.
- Coordinate quality control checks in order to deliver project according to class and owner quality requirements
Requirements
- Degree in Mechanical or Marine Engineering (or equivalent).
- 4 to 6 years relevant experience in project management in shipbuilding or marine engineering
- Strong leadership, communication, interpersonal and planning skills.
- Ability to produce and present effective and comprehensive reports.
- Able to delegate tasks and manage people professionally.
- Preferably Turkish Speaker but not mandatory
This role is essential for supporting the smooth execution of yacht building projects, ensuring they meet all necessary standards and client expectations.
